Processador neander-x
8 bits para representar uma instrução b) Quantos bits são utilizados para representar um endereço?
8 bits para representar um endereço c) Como são representados os números inteiros negativos?
N (Negativo) é indicado pelo numero “1”. d) Quantas instruções podem existir?
O número de instruções do NEANDER-X é pequeno, apenas 16. e) Qual o tamanho máximo de memória endereçável?
Uma memória de 256 posições (endereços) x 8 bits f) Quais são os registradores disponíveis?
• AC: um registrador de 8 bits
• PC: um registrador de 8 bits (registrador-contador)
• RI: um registrador de 4 bits (ou 8)
• RDM: um registrador de 8 bits (largura do dado)
• REM: um registrador de 8 bits (largura do endereço) g) Qual o formato de uma instrução?
São formados por 1 ou 2 bytes
O processador Neander-X não é utilizado comercialmente. Escreva um relatório que compare o Neander a um processador comercial (você pode escolher!) demonstrando o porquê deste processador ser apenas acadêmico.
* NeanderCaracterísticas– Largura de dados e endereços de 8 bits– Dados representados em complemento de dois– 1 acumulador de 8 bits (AC)– 1 apontador de programa de 8 bits (PC)– 1 registrador de estado com 2 códigos de condição: negativo (N) e zero (Z) | * RamsesCaracterísticas– quatro modos de endereçamento,– dois registradores de uso geral,– um registrador de índice,– indicadores de carry, negativo e zero,– instruções adicionais (chamada de subrotina, negação e deslocamento de bits) |
Comparação entre os dois processadores: Neander– Instruções: 11*n + 8– Leituras: 27*n + 18– Escritas: 4*n + 3Ramses– Instruções: 5*n + 8– Leituras: 11*n + 13– Escritas: 1 |
P.S> O NEANDER é um computador muito simples sendo utilizado apenas para estudos devido a sua